Output 5af0dd8a13eff60d6cf2849afc91723a154579aba898e19d581952bff35edb7f:105

value
667868938
script pubkey
OP_0 OP_PUSHBYTES_32 dc69c42fbe93d06348d51d844a702943477670d22f397379e23bca92e47cce91
address
bc1qm35ugta7j0gxxjx4rkzy5upfgdrhvuxj9uuhx70z809f9erue6gsf08gw9
transaction
5af0dd8a13eff60d6cf2849afc91723a154579aba898e19d581952bff35edb7f
spent
true